On Thursday, March 14, Rosemary Heilemann and Joyce Williams, co-founders of the Electoral College Committee, LWV Illinois, will present End the Electoral College: Elect the President by Popular Vote. Sponsored by LWV Edina, the presentation will be on Zoom.
During the League of Women Voters’ 2022 national convention, LWVUS board president Dr. Deborah Turner announced the League’s next “moonshot” goal: abolition of the Electoral College. As an organization whose mission is to empower voters and defend democracy, the LWV has long supported abolishing the Electoral College in favor of directly electing the President and Vice President of the United States. This presentation will help develop a deeper understanding of how the Electoral College impacts presidential elections. Heilemann and Williams will outline the LWV's position on ending the Electoral College, as well as why arguments supporting the Electoral College are based on myths rather than facts.
